The 349 showcases an unparalleled combination of features that further Island Packet's unwavering commitment to meeting the needs and desires of the cruising sailor. The renowned Island Packet reputation of superb seakeeping and safety, exceptional comfort and livability, outstanding build quality, award-winning value and customer satisfaction remain well intact.
With this model, Island Packet has returned to the Solent-style rig as standard, featuring a mainsail with a working jib furled with Harken systems. The working jib is fitted with a Hoyt Boom that is self-tending and improves performance with its close sheeting and self-vanging feature, while the large optional reacher or asymmetrical boost performance in light air or when off the wind. The fully battened mainsail is equipped with a low friction Battcar system and drops easily into a stack pack with an integral cover and lazy jack system. This rigging offers ease of use and versatility in varied wind or sea conditions and increased speed and manuveurability. All sheets lead to the cockpit primary winches at the helm for short-handed convenience. She has more than ample horsepower with the Yanmar 45 HP Yanmar diesel engine.

- One-piece integral hull and keel of 100% hand laminated high modulus knitted fiberglass infused with a proprietary pressure-fed application system. Light ivory gelcoat with urethane painted boot stripe.
- Fully encapsulated lead ballast forms double bottom over length of keel. No keel bolts to maintain, loosen or leak.
- Molded structural interior grid unit bonded with hull and interior bulkhead system to form unified structure.
- Chainplates interlocked and bonded directly with hull structure for secure “belt-and-suspenders” installation.
- PolyClad3 hull gel system includes ten-year pro-rated limited warranty against osmotic blisters.
- Deck laminate features Divinycel, virtually eliminating the potential for deck deterioration associated with other core materials. Includes a 10-year pro-rated limited warranty against deck core-degradation or delamination, an industry exclusive.
- Two-tone deck surfaces: light ivory with tan premium diamond pattern slip resistant surfaces.
- One-piece deck attached to integral hull flange with bolts, lock nuts and urethane adhesive sealant. Hardware backed with aluminum plates where required.
- Molded fiberglass headliner with textured finish.
- Harken headsail roller furling systems.
- Hoyt Boom equipped self-vanging jib or staysail for ease of handling, improved performance and superb adaptability to a wide range of wind and sea conditions.
- Anondized aluminum mast and booms; wire rigging.
- Mid-boom sheeting for unobstructed cockpit and dodger installations.

- 45hp Yanmar 4JH45 series diesel four-cylinder engine, fresh water cooled, rubber isolation mounts on reinforced fiberglass bed with integral oil pan, mechanical fuel pump, 110 amp Balmar alternator and digital DuoCharge controller. A 3-bladed fixed prop, Racor fuel filter with water separator mounted for easy access. Jacketed fuel lines with swedged and threaded fittings, intake strainer.
- Engine access from removable front and rear panels, hinged side opening doors. Pre-plumbed for electric oil change system.
- Extensive sound-control with premium lead-lined insulation, gasketed access doors and panels.

- Pressure water system with hot and cold service to galley, head and cockpit shower. 6 gallon water heater with engine heat exchanger, insulated hot water hoses throughout. Dedicated head, sink/shower drain sump with strainer.
- LPG system with 10 pound aluminum tank in self-draining storage compartment with gasketed, lockable lid, remote solenoid, dual safety shutoffs and gauge; room for extra tank.
- Fuel, water and holding tanks below cabin sole maximize storage and stability and minimize trim changes with varying tank fluid levels.
- Fuel tank constructed of welded, baffled heavy gauge marine-grade aluminum with shut off valve, s/s deck fill, tank mounted mechanical gauge. Pre-plumbed with second pickup/return for addition of generator and/or heater system.
- ThermoCure fresh water tank constructed of infusion molded fiberglass using FDA approved vinylester resins, baffles, s/s deck fill, electronic remote tank level gauge.
- Infusion molded fiberglass holding tank with baffles, s/s deck pump out fitting, electronic remote tank level gauge.
- Heavy-duty Rule 3700 electric bilge pump with auto control and premium WaterWitch electronic pump switch. BilgeAlert high water bilge alarm with remote alarm panel at helm.
- UL listed bronze, thru-bolted, flanged seacocks on all thru hulls below waterline; ball valves on thru-hulls in boot stripe.
